How much time your youngster will require to use dental braces relies on the issues the orthodontist is trying to repair, but the average has to do with 2 years. Afterwards, your child may use a specifically shaped retainer-- a small, tough item of plastic with metal cords or a slice of plastic formed like a mouthguard. Retainers keep the teeth from roaming back to their initial locations. Conventional braces consist of typical steel braces that are put on your teeth with an adhesive and also linked by cable. They need periodic tightening every 4-6 weeks so stable stress can progressively align your teeth and also align your jaw. The best method of avoiding damage to your support is to merely beware what you eat as well as just how difficult you attack. Hard and also crunchy foods as well as treats such as toffee are off the food selection up until your therapy is finished. Apples or crusty bread can still be eaten, yet do not attack into them-- reduced them up right into small pieces initially.
